🔹 Getting Started
Charge your new battery fully before you use it for the first time. Over the next few charge cycles, run your device down to around 20% before you recharge—this helps the battery perform its best. After that, charge whenever you need to.
🔹 Keep It Healthy
Avoid letting your battery completely drain or staying plugged in constantly. Both extremes wear it out faster. Store the battery in a cool, dry place when you're not using it, since heat damages batteries quickly.

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 2019 — 3.85V Li-Polymer Replacement Battery (SWD-WT-N8)
This 3.85V, 5100mAh Li-Polymer battery replaces the original SWD-WT-N8 cell in the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 2019. It fits the SM-T290, SM-T295, and SM-T295N models. Install it when the original cell no longer holds a useful charge or the tablet shuts down unexpectedly under normal use.
- SM-T290 and SM-T295 platform: Both the Wi-Fi-only SM-T290 and the LTE SM-T295 share the same battery bay, connector pinout, and charge IC. One replacement cell fits the full range without modification.
- Bench tested on actual hardware: We ran this cell through charge and discharge cycles on SM-T290 and SM-T295 units. The charge IC accepted the cell on first connection, BMS handshake completed without fault codes, and the tablet reached full charge without thermal events.
- Fuel gauge reset after installation: After fitting this cell, run the tablet down to automatic shutoff, then charge it uninterrupted to 100% without using it mid-cycle. That single full cycle resets the fuel gauge IC calibration against the new cell and clears the inaccurate percentage readings that appear after a swap.
Tablet shutting down at 15–25% after battery replacement
The fuel gauge IC carries calibration data from the old cell into the new installation. When display backlight and Wi-Fi or LTE radio draw simultaneously, the combined load causes a brief voltage drop. If the gauge still maps that drop against the old cell's curve, it reads the voltage as critically low and triggers shutdown — even though the new cell has charge remaining. One full discharge to automatic cutoff followed by an uninterrupted charge to 100% realigns the gauge to the new cell's actual voltage curve. After that cycle, shutdowns in the 15–25% range should stop.
Fast charging not available after fitting the new cell
Adaptive fast charge on the Tab A 8.0 2019 requires the charge IC to complete one accepted charge handshake with the new cell before it enables higher current delivery. If you plug in immediately after installation and the percentage display is still unstable, the IC may default to standard 5V charging as a precaution. Let the tablet complete one full charge cycle at the standard rate first. On the next charge after that cycle, fast charge should re-engage automatically — no settings change needed.

Frequently Asked Questions
My Galaxy Tab A 8.0 is jumping from 30% to 5% and shutting off — did I get a faulty battery?
The cell itself is not the issue. The fuel gauge IC inside the tablet was calibrated to the worn-out original cell, and it's still using that old data to read the new one. Discharge the tablet completely until it shuts itself off, then plug it in and charge it straight to 100% without interrupting the cycle or using the tablet mid-charge. That single cycle resets the IC calibration against the new cell's actual voltage curve, and the erratic percentage jumps stop.
The battery percentage drops fast from 100% but then slows down — is the capacity wrong?
Capacity is correct at 5100mAh. What you're seeing is fuel gauge drift — the IC's discharge model is still weighted toward the old cell's degraded curve, which compresses the top end and stretches the bottom. Run one full discharge to automatic shutoff, then charge uninterrupted to 100%. After that recalibration cycle, the gauge redistributes percentage across the full cell capacity and the drop from 100% levels out to a normal rate.
Fast charging worked before I replaced the battery — now it only shows standard charging. What changed?
The charge IC defaults to 5V standard charging on first contact with a new cell until it completes one full accepted charge handshake. This is normal behaviour, not a fault. Let the tablet finish one complete standard-rate charge from low to 100% without interruption. On the following charge session, the IC recognises the cell as verified and re-enables adaptive fast charge automatically.
